Vintage Omega Constellation Automatic "TV Screen" Green Dial - Ref. 168.044 - Cal. 1001
Description:
Up for sale from my personal collection is a stunning and rare Omega Constellation Automatic "TV Screen" from the 1970s. This timepiece perfectly captures the futuristic design era of the 70s, featuring a highly sought-after, beautiful green dial.
Technical Specifications & Details:
Reference Number: 168.044
Movement: Omega Caliber 1001 Automatic, officially certified Chronometer, 20 Jewels (Movement Serial: 33122912).
Case Dimensions: 34.2 mm width (excluding crown) / 40.9 mm Lug-to-Lug. Iconic TV-shaped vintage profile.
Case Material: 40 Microns gold-plated bezel/upper case (Carrure-Lunette Plaque Or G 40 Microns) with a stainless steel caseback (Fond Acier Inoxydable).
Caseback: Features the iconic and crisp Omega Constellation "Observatory" medallion.
Dial: Beautiful green dial, professionally restored / refinished. Features a date window at the 3 o'clock position.
Strap & Buckle: Fitted with a matching green alligator-grain leather strap and buckle, which are aftermarket (not original to the watch) and measure 20-16 mm.
Condition:
The watch is in very good vintage condition. The original Omega Cal. 1001 movement is clean and running well. The case retains its sharp lines, and the substantial 40-micron gold plating shows beautifully for its age. A rare green-dialed Omega classic, ready to be worn or added to a fine vintage collection.
